The role provides financial, administrative, and clerical support by ensuring timely receipt of payments related to energy and statutory bills. The position is responsible for accurate posting of receipts, maintaining billing records, resolving discrepancies, and ensuring compliance with established processes in an efficient and timely manner.
- Maintain the billing system in SAP S/4HANA.
- Generate invoices and account statements for energy supplies based on meter readings.
- Maintain accurate accounts receivable records and ensure proper posting of transactions.
- Engage with clients regularly for payment follow-ups and invoice-related clarifications.
- Share and collect NDCs on a routine basis.
- Examine customer payment plans, history, and credit lines to support steady cash flow.
- Investigate and resolve irregularities, discrepancies, and billing/collection-related enquiries.
- Resolve valid or authorized deductions through adjusting entries.
- Address invalid or unauthorized deductions as per established procedures.
- Reconcile the accounts receivable ledger to ensure all receipts are accurately accounted for.
- Produce monthly financial and management reports.
- Maintain all accounts receivable files, records, and supporting documentation.
- Graduate or Postgraduate in Accounting, Finance, or Economics.
- 1–3 years of experience in bookkeeping or accounts receivable roles.
- Hands-on experience with SAP S/4HANA preferred.
- Strong understanding of general accounting principles, compliance standards, and regulatory requirements.
- Ability to calculate, post, and manage accounting figures and financial records.
- Proficiency in MS Office, especially Excel, and ability to operate computerized accounting systems.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
- Effective organizational, time management, and stress management abilities.
-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within diverse teams.
- Clear and efficient communication skills for coordination across internal and external stakeholders.
- Multilingual candidates preferred.
